Transaction: fe391fb9c95ea0b18b105cd74d4ba8223dc98d99bbe515a183933651ae2425ee

Block Hash: 0000000d2e458d5e7d357cfa2dd7bfd503721a5e733e776cab003f1ab70abfc9

Confirmations: 3014872

Timestamp: 2017-05-23 12:42:40

Amount: 21.63

Is Block Reward: Yes

Reward Type: PoW

Inputs

Sender Address Amount
Coinbase ( PoW) 21.63

Outputs

Recipient Address Amount
SMreWpT7b4M7fmeiop9nZep9j8P1g6PD3D 21.63